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y has rejected calls for Ukraine to agree to an immediate ceasefire in its war with Russia, stating that a cessation of hostilities without detailed security guarantees would be a “failure for everyone.” Zelenskyy said he saw no need to make amends for an explosive row with US President Donald Trump at the White House on Friday or come up with a plan to restore his relationship with the Trump. “This relationship will continue because this is more than a relationship in one moment,” said Zelenskyy.
Zelenskyy said Russia’s failure to abide by a ceasefire in eastern Ukraine after invading in 2014 convinced him that it would be a mistake to agree to stop fighting without an enforcement mechanism backed up by military force.

“If you don’t have an end to the war and you don’t have security guarantees, no one is able to control a ceasefire,” Zelenskyy said from London’s Stansted airport.
In a post on social media, Zelenskyy said that Ukraine have support from European countries. "As a result of these days, we see clear support from Europe. Even more unity, even more willingness to cooperate. Everyone is united on the main issue – for peace to be real, we need real security guarantees. And this is the position of all of Europe – the entire continent. The United Kingdom, the European Union, Türkiye," he stated in a video posted on X.

"Of course, we understand the importance of America, and we are grateful for all the support we’ve received from the United States. There has not been a day when we haven’t felt gratitude. It’s gratitude for the preservation of our independence – our resilience in Ukraine is based on what our partners are doing for us – and for their own security," he stated further.
"What we need is peace, not endless war. And that’s why we say security guarantees are the key to this," he said.
